Rental income from property in Gwadar depends more on property type than exact location. A well-placed shop rents out faster than a house, and a house rents faster than an apartment, mostly because Gwadar’s rental demand still skews commercial and short-term over residential and long-term.

What Rents Fastest

Shops on the main commercial corridor lease quickest, since businesses tied to port and logistics activity need space now, not eventually. Houses come next, mostly to workers and officials on medium-term postings.

Realistic Yield Expectations

Commercial rental yields in Gwadar tend to run higher than residential, reflecting both stronger demand and the fact that residential rental culture is still developing compared to established cities like Lahore or Karachi.

What Affects Your Actual Return

Vacancy periods matter more here than in a mature rental market. Budget for gaps between tenants, especially for residential property, rather than assuming the unit stays occupied year-round.
